The Radeon R7 M440 GPU by AMD. features a GCN 3.0 (2014−2019) architecture. with 320 CUDA cores. It offers DDR3 memory with 4 GB GB capacity and a 64 Bit-bit interface. delivering a bandwidth of 14.4 GB/s GB/s. it supports DirectX 12 (12_0), Vulkan 1.2.131 for enhanced performance.
